Why is it important for you to stay fit during your pregnancy? I honestly believe it is good for the health of both my baby and myself.  I have talked to many moms and my doctor and they all reiterate the same thing that working out is so important as it helps with the pregnancy and with the delivery of the baby. As a result I have had no body aches and have felt fantastic throughout my entire pregnancy (I am 36 weeks pregnant). Also as I have had to cut out caffeine, working out first thing in the morning gives me the energy I need to make it through the day.

What is your motivation to get out of bed so early each day to push yourself? I know that at the end of the run/workout those endorphins will kick in and last throughout the rest of the day. Not only does it give me energy but I am in a good mood throughout the entire day. Also since I have been going to bed around 9:30 to 10 every night, it makes it a lot easier to get up earlier.  

What is your plan to stay fit when the baby arrives? As I have been working out consistently throughout my pregnancy (Fit4Mom classes and running), I believe that after the baby comes getting back into a regular workout routine should hopefully not be as challenging. With the help of my husband, I plan to start running/going to Fit4Mom classes within a couple of weeks (sooner if possible) after the baby arrives. I also plan to take advantage of the treadmill I have since it will be very chilly in January.

how will you balance work, parenthood and exercise? This will be a tough one. That said I plan on hopefully being able to carve out at least 45minutes to one hour a day for my workouts first thing in the morning. Doing it early in the morning ensures that I will get my workout in and also my husband can help with coverage. As for balancing work and parenthood I plan to work from home as much as possible but I believe this will be a ongoing challenge.
